The wartime letters and diaries of Flt Lt Henry Chessell are a piece of social history. Although they do not have the excitement of battles fought and won on foreign fields and there is no smell of cordite, the personal records of war on the home front, set against the backdrop of international events, give a good impression of the slow, relentless, grind and struggle of the civilian population over six years of war. They also give a tantalizing glimpse of the contribution made to the war effort by some of the unseen ’backroom’ R.A.F. and inter-service units that were working under a cloak of secrecy.
